Créer une instance en ligne de commande

Bonjour,
J’utilise depuis un moment Diacamma sur un linux Ubuntu (base de donnée sqlite).
Je souhaite maintenant mettre en client serveur pour pouvoir l’utiliser lorsque je suis en déplacement et permettre l’accès aux copropriétaires.
J’ai pour cela une freebox delta sur laquelle je tente d’installer un VM (architecture ARM)

J’ai dans un premier temps installé sqlite, ensuite installé le script d’installation de Diacamma.
Ayant le problème d’environnement virtuel, j’ai installé le paquet python pour environnement virtuel puis relancé le script d’installation.

Tout semble se dérouler normalement. Seulement, lorsque je rentre sur un ordinateur de mon réseau l’adresse IP du serveur, le site ne se lance pas. Je pense que c’est parce que l’instance n’est pas créée.

Mon soucis est que je ne peux installer d’interface graphique et n’ai accès à la VM qu’en mode console.

Mes questions :

  • Comment créer une nouvelle instance en ligne de commande (basée sur sqlite)
  • Comment pouvoir récupérer ma sauvegarde de comptabilité pour tout réinjecter lorsque cela fonctionnera ?

Merci de votre aide.
Bonnes fêtes de fin d’année à tous

Bonjour,

Pour les démarches d’auto-hébergement sous Linux, il y a cette article qui explique cela très bien:
https://www.diacamma.org/forum/t/installation-manuelle-diacamma-syndic-sur-ubuntu
Il l’explique sous Debian x86_64 avec PostgreSQL mais vous arriverez à vous inspirer dans votre cas.
Le souci que vous avez eu doit être sur la dernière partie : création du service pour lancer l’instance automatiquement.

Pour la restauration, regardez l’article https://www.diacamma.org/forum/t/restauration-sous-debian-12

Merci,
J’ai écrémé les posts du forum mais manifestement, j’ai loupé celui-ci.
Est ce possible de prendre une sauvegarde sous sqlite et de l’injecter sous PostgreSQL ou dois je rester avec le même type de base de donnée ?

Oui, c’est tout le but de passé par le mécanisme d’archivage/restauration : pouvoir reprendre des données SQLite vers PostgreSQL (ou vice-versa)